Cost of Fire Remediation in West Palm Beach

Dealing with the aftermath of a fire in West Palm Beach, FL, can be overwhelming, both emotionally and financially. Understanding the cost of fire remediation is crucial for homeowners and businesses as they plan for restoration and recovery. This guide provides insights into the factors that influence remediation costs and the typical expenses associated with common tasks.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Extent of Damage: The severity of the fire damage significantly impacts the overall cost.
  • Type of Fire: Different types of fires (electrical, grease, etc.) leave different residues and require varying levels of cleanup.
  • Size of Affected Area: Larger areas will naturally incur higher costs due to more extensive labor and materials.
  • Materials Affected: Costs can vary depending on whether the fire affected structural elements, personal belongings, or specialized equipment.
  • Water Damage: Firefighting efforts often result in water damage, adding to the remediation costs.
  • Soot and Smoke Removal: The complexity of removing soot and smoke can influence the overall expense.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ates in West Palm Beach, FL, can vary, affecting the total cost of remediation.

Common Tasks and Costs

Task Average Cost (West Palm Beach, FL)
Initial Assessment $200 - $500
Debris Removal $500 - $1,500
Structural Repairs $1,000 - $5,000
Soot and Smoke Cleanup $2,000 - $6,000
Water Damage Restoration $1,500 - $4,000
Odor Removal $200 - $1,000
Full Property Restoration $10,000 - $50,000+
